Output 31a8ddc421667fd5360c69818542be8aa5985128d0d52a1aed8d9572200118d0:0
- value
- 21383199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 063a624a20dd6bf6af592f20c6648d1e9c1964ad OP_EQUAL
- address
- M8U6EAjixSPpfMoiMN41MMMtPZDScc1vNu
- transaction
- 31a8ddc421667fd5360c69818542be8aa5985128d0d52a1aed8d9572200118d0
- spent
- true